trjford8    -- 08-08-2016 @ 4:53 PM
  Robert, use the two suppliers I have mentioned. They have all the instructions and parts to begin your project. You will find that you may need to buy additional fittings for your hoses as you may need some 45 degree fittings. Check around your area for another car guy who has done air in an old car. Their experience will be very helpful in leading you through the project. It's not difficult,but a first timer should have some guidance. The toughest part is making up your hoses and finding someone to crimp them.
